Output d40c644dc31eb55c70c0deb10d6bf323a69fadfaa6f25b8727962f537cfe6702:5

value
16623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258f806a785f6cc38d9825f932684da5df3d2663 OP_EQUAL
address
357cqJtFRAN4RwjgrgLF2gPqCVMxb4D8nM
transaction
d40c644dc31eb55c70c0deb10d6bf323a69fadfaa6f25b8727962f537cfe6702